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36993 4325 226 427412925 927474165
3909 742105832
3909 742105832
05407 63579976 06655 0863998371 411
All about undefined
Interested in learning more?
3909 742105832
05407 63579976 06655 0863998371 411
See more
2450 243364 3768323
99 9148892 77324 242730102
See more
13923303 68428
722 72 347214093
See more